[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: `global-set-key' vs `keymap-global-set' `key-valid-p' syntax
From: |
Emanuel Berg |
Subject: |
Re: `global-set-key' vs `keymap-global-set' `key-valid-p' syntax |
Date: |
Tue, 07 May 2024 15:43:22 +0200 |
User-agent: |
Gnus/5.13 (Gnus v5.13) |
> However there is one use case I don't know how to translate
> to the new format, it looks, for example, like this:
>
> (define-key input-decode-map [?\u1000] [M-S-RET-a])
> (global-set-key [M-S-RET-a] (lambda () (interactive) (message "hit
> M-S-RET")))
Here is another example of the same thing, almost.
;;; -*- lexical-binding: t -*-
;;
;; this file:
;; https://dataswamp.org/~incal/emacs-init/signal.el
;;
;; test from Emacs:
;; (signal-process (emacs-pid) 'sigusr1)
;;
;; test from zsh:
;; $ kill -s usr1 $(pidof emacs)
(defun signal-usr1-f ()
(interactive)
(message "USR1 signal") )
(define-key special-event-map [sigusr1] #'signal-usr1-f)
(provide 'signal)
--
underground experts united
https://dataswamp.org/~incal